WebAug 7, 2024 · The net electric field at point P is the vector sum of electric fields E1 and E2, where: (Ex)net = ∑Ex = Ex1 +Ex2. (Ey)net = ∑Ey = Ey1 + Ey2. Enet = √(Ex)2 +(Ey)2. So, in order to find the net electric field at point P, we will have to analyze the electric field produced by each charge and how they interact (cancel or add together). WebTwo 10-cm-diameter charged rings face each other, 20 cm apart. Both rings are charged to + 20 nC. What is the electric field strength at (a) the midpoint between the two rings and (b) the center of the left ring?
